        "content": "<p>West Java Governor Dedi Mulyadi has launched a sharp critique against\nthe management of Regional-Owned Enterprises (BUMD) in his province. He\nassessed that the operations of several West Java BUMDs are currently\nrife with brokering practices, lack transparency, and involve illogical\ncooperation schemes that ultimately harm the regional treasury.<\/p>\n<p>The criticism was delivered by Dedi while attending the\ngroundbreaking ceremony for the Legok Nangka waste-to-energy power plant\nproject in Bandung on Wednesday (29\/7). According to him, the\nirregularities in BUMD management have a direct impact on the public\nbecause profits that should be deposited into the regional treasury are\ninstead retained internally by the companies.<\/p>\n<p>Dedi highlighted one practice he deemed nonsensical, specifically\nregarding the profit-sharing funds from oil and gas managed by PT\nPertamina. He argued that these funds should be directly deposited into\nthe West Java Provincial Government\u2019s treasury to finance\ndevelopment.<\/p>\n<p>\u2018Why isn\u2019t it going directly to the regional treasury? What is the\nimpact? For years, it has gone to the BUMD, and the BUMD has not\ntransferred it to the regional treasury,\u2019 Dedi stated. He added that the\nfunds are often reinvested by the BUMD to create new entities with\nunclear urgency.<\/p>\n<p>\u2018Instead of helping development, the profit-sharing funds evaporate\nwithout a trace because they are reinvested by the BUMD. They create\nsubsidiaries, sub-subsidiaries, and even sub-sub-subsidiaries,\u2019 he\nstressed. Dedi acknowledged that he has reported this anomaly in\nbureaucratic governance directly to President Prabowo Subianto.<\/p>\n<p>Beyond the oil and gas issue, Dedi also scrutinised the cooperation\nscheme for the provision of Trans Jabar mass transportation between the\nWest Java Provincial Government, the BUMD PT Jasa Sarana, and PT DAMRI.\nHe believes the BUMD\u2019s involvement in this project merely creates a\nbureaucratic chain that burdens the regional budget.<\/p>\n<p>Under the current scheme, the West Java Provincial Government does\nnot pay DAMRI directly but instead channels payments through PT Jasa\nSarana. As a result, the BUMD enjoys a double profit from a percentage\nof the contract value and operational fees from provincial revenue.<\/p>\n<p>\u2018Jasa Sarana gets two things: one, 5 percent of the IDR 120 billion\ncontract; two, operational costs from the provincial revenue,\u2019 Dedi\nexplained.<\/p>\n<p>As a corrective measure, Dedi confirmed he will revise the\ncooperation scheme starting next month. He asserted that he will sever\nthe BUMD\u2019s role as an \u2018intermediary\u2019 in public services that can be\nconducted directly.<\/p>\n<p>\u2018Next week I will change the strange ones again. Starting in August,\nI will cut it out, the provincial government will deal directly with\nDAMRI, no more going through Jasa Sarana. This is extraordinary\nbrokering, and it has been going on for years,\u2019 he concluded.<\/p>\n<p>Dedi hopes that by cleaning up brokering practices within the BUMDs,\nWest Java\u2019s Regional Original Revenue can increase significantly and the\nbenefits can be felt directly by the public through tangible development\nprogrammes.<\/p>",
